Record Temperatures in San Diego

by Leslie Crawford on January 19, 2009Thank you

According to records dating to 1850, 81 degrees is the highest January temperature recorded in San Diego. Well, Coronado surpassed that yesterday with a temperature of 86 degrees!!! The only other temperature that recorded higher than that was Escondido at 88 degrees.

As far as the garden goes, water early in the day so all the water can dry off foliage before things cool off in the afternoon. We’re supposed to get rain on Thursday (promises, promises!) but a good deep soaking is not a bad idea because the weather has been so dry and warm. My garden is confused!
